Yellow Jacket Boys rule at home; Lady Yellow Jackets finish Second

</element><element id="paragraph-1" type="body"><![CDATA[The Chester Yellow Jackets boys track team ruled over their second home meet while the Lady Jackets finished second on their side of the meet .

The boys scored 233 points to dominate the meet over Christopher (147), Red Bud (69), Waterloo Gibault (38), Vienna (18) and New Athens (12). Shawnee and Steeleville didn&#39;t score.

The girls(153) finished behind the Red Bud girls total of 173 points. Also participating in the meet were Christopher (105), Vienna (37), New Athens (24) and Waterloo (Gibault) (10). Shawnee and Steeleville didn&#39;t score.

Scoring for the Lady Jackets were;Chelsea Schroeder finished fourth in the discus (62' 1"), finished sixth in the 100 (:14.4) and finished fifth in the shot put (23' 5.5"). Alexandria Fedderke finished sixth in the discus (58' 4") and finished third in the 200 (:30.2). McKenzi Rucker finished second in the long jump (14' 9"). De'Na Nesbitt finished third in the long jump (14' 5") and won the pole vault (6' 0"). Rachel Clendenin tied for first place in the high jump (4' 2"), won the 300 hurdles (:53.5) and finished fourth in the 100 hurdle(:18.8). Maribeth Lawrence finished second in the triple jump (27' 9"). Jenna Wingerter finished third in the triple jump (27' 7") and finished sixth in the 200 (:31.2). Brandi Phelps finished second in the pole vault (5' 6"). Emily Reid finished third in the 3200 (14:03.2) and finished third in the 800 (2:49.5).

Sarah Bindel won the 100 hurdles (:16.7) and finished third in the 400 (1:06.2). Taylor Yankey finished second in the 800 (2:46.3) and finished fourth in the 1600 (6:47.8). Kaitlin Brunkhorst finished sixth in the 400 (1:15.7). Chester won the 800 relay ( Lawrence,Fedderke,Nesbitt,Hartmann), 1600 relay (Lawrence,Hartmann ,Nesbitt ,Bindel) and second in the 400 relay.

Scoring for the Jackets were; Brad Bindel won the discus (119' 5") and finished third in the shot put (37' 1"). Trent Eggemeyer finished fourth in the discus (100' 5"). Jacob Fogle finished second in the shot put (37' 1.5"). Kyle Landon won the long jump (20' 8"), the high jump (6' 9") and the triple jump (42' 5"). Issiac Wingerter tied for fourth in the high jump (5' 2"), finished second in the 200 (:24.9) and won the 300 hurdles (:47.5). Zach Sternberg won the pole vault (10' 6"), finished fourth in the 1600 (5:36(5:36.6) and finished fourth in the 3200 (12:10.2). David Luchman finished second in the pole vault. Caleb Golding finished second in the 110 hurdles (:21.0). Andrew Frazer won the 100 (:11.7) and won the 200 (:24.5). Nick Rinehart finished third in the 100 (:12.4). Devin Valleroy won the 800 (2:16.0) and finished second in the 300 hurdles (:48.7). William Stafford finished third in the 800 (2:22.1) and second in the 1600 (5:26.1). Verne White won the 400 (:54.0). Robin Bochert finished second in the 400 (1:00.3). In the relays, Chester finished second in the 3200 (9:39.8), won the 400 (:47.8), won the 800 (1:41.6) and won the 1600 (4:21.3).
